Hi. I am glad that you are interested in my course. Here you will understand a little more about what you can expect from the course:
First, I will clarify which businesses can use cash bookkeeping.
Second, I will explain how the cash bookkeeping cycle works.
After that, I will introduce the Google Sheets templates that we will use for this course.
I will also go through the invoice template and tell you which functions I’ve used for this template.
Next, I will talk about the chart of accounts and its meaning in cash accounting and how to add it to your Revenue Book and Expense Book in Google Sheets.
Last but not least, I will show you how to set up the profit and loss report to automatically pull information from the Revenue Book and Expense Book.
Once we create the Google Sheets templates, I will walk you through their practical use. This means I will show you how to accurately and effectively record and track your business money-in and money-out using all four bookkeeping templates.
The course will conclude with a video that will show you how to read financial information from your Profit and Loss Statement.
